Amgen (AMGN) has seen significant share price gains over multiple years. Despite these gains, a Discounted Cash Flow (DCF) analysis suggests the stock is undervalued by 42.2%, with an estimated intrinsic value of $647.81 per share compared to its recent price of $374.75. The article also presents “Narratives” for investors, offering bull and bear case valuations based on differing assumptions about future growth, product pipelines, and market risks.
